A 40 Gbit/s TDM transmitter and receiver subsystem pair based on optical multiplexing/demultiplexing has been implemented. Back-to-back receiver sensitivities from –29.0 to –26.5 dBm and Q factors in excess of 18 were achieved. With 560 km of dispersion-shifted fibre (DSF), system Q factors in excess of 8 (BER ≃ 6.3 × 10-16) were maintained over a signal wavelength range of 2.5 nm.
